1,000 Books Before Kindergarten (Ages 0-5)
1,000 Books Before Kindergarten (Ages 0-5)
Shared reading is the best way to help babies, toddlers and preschoolers develop the important early literacy skills they need to learn how to read independently later on. The more books children ages 0-5 hear, the more prepared they will be to learn how to read.
- Every time you read any book to your little one, log it on Beanstack! Even if it's the same book 10 times, log it 10 times.
- For every 200 books that are read, children will get a prize book.
- After 1,000 books are read, participants can stop by the library to get their final prize book. They can also put their name on a customized magnet that will be featured on Kids’ World’s 1,000 Books Before Kindergarten display.
Read 500 (Grades K-3)
Read 500 (Grades K-3)
- Register every year in September and pick up a paper log at the library. The program will last from September through May.
- Log how many minutes your child reads. Enter the exact number of minutes you read, and Beanstack will keep track of your total as you approach 500 minutes.
- Receive a digital badge every time you read for 500 minutes. Visit the Kids' World Desk for a matching animal sticker to add to your paper log.
- Earn a free book for every three badges you earn. If you read 500 minutes every month, you can earn three free books every year!
- Make sure to log your reading on Beanstack regularly to be entered into our monthly prize drawings! At the end of every month, anyone who logs minutes on Beanstack will be eligible for a random prize drawing.
100 Books Before High School (Grades 4-8)
100 Books Before High School (Grades 4-8)
- Register on Beanstack anytime.
- Receive a drawstring bag just for signing up.
- Log every book you read on Beanstack.
- For every 20 books logged, you’ll earn a badge and a free book.
- Stop by the Kids’ World or Hub Desks to choose from a selection of prize books, and get a real-life badge to wear proudly.
FourScore (Grades 9-12)
FourScore (Grades 9-12)
- Sign up for FourScore on Beanstack.
- Read books from the AISLE Lincoln Award Nominees list and vote for your favorite.
- Read four books and you'll score a free book.
- Vote for your favorite book between February 15 through March 15 and earn a Bluetooth speaker.
- Read all 20 Lincoln Award Nominees to complete the ultimate FourScore challenge - and earn a customer 3D printed trophy!
